diff options
| author | Mathieu Arnold <mat@FreeBSD.org> | 2016-07-27 15:09:11 +0000 |
|---|---|---|
| committer | Mathieu Arnold <mat@FreeBSD.org> | 2016-07-27 15:09:11 +0000 |
| commit | 56bf85096cc89f91d28671b5d93b4172240263bc (patch) | |
| tree | 0574ce9eee45d627f943b80b2445882a762b52af /benchmarks/ubench/files/patch-diskbench.c | |
| parent | 26b078f5434c79c09183a623d0c9897d12fd26c9 (diff) | |
Cleanup patches, category benchmarks
Rename them to follow the make makepatch naming, and regenerate them.
With hat: portmgr
Sponsored by: Absolight
Diffstat (limited to 'benchmarks/ubench/files/patch-diskbench.c')
| -rw-r--r-- | benchmarks/ubench/files/patch-diskbench.c | 45 |
1 files changed, 45 insertions, 0 deletions
diff --git a/benchmarks/ubench/files/patch-diskbench.c b/benchmarks/ubench/files/patch-diskbench.c new file mode 100644 index 000000000000..f9aa483075fc --- /dev/null +++ b/benchmarks/ubench/files/patch-diskbench.c @@ -0,0 +1,45 @@ +--- diskbench.c.orig 2000-07-31 17:24:10 UTC ++++ diskbench.c +@@ -103,7 +103,7 @@ double cdt; + return i; + } + /*****************************************************************************/ +-int diskbench() ++int diskbench(int diskbench_time) + { + int sv[2],i; + int d=0; +@@ -115,7 +115,7 @@ int diskbench() + return 0; + } + cpu_score=0; +- alarm(DISKBENCH_TIME); ++ alarm(diskbench_time); + switch ( (i=sigsetjmp(env,0xffff)) ) + { + case 0: +@@ -124,7 +124,7 @@ int diskbench() + for (i=0;i<child_number;i++) kill(child_pid[i],SIGALRM); + if ( child ) exit(0); + close(sv[0]); +- dlt=(double )cpu_score*(double )itim; ++ dlt=(double )cpu_score * DISKBENCH_TIME * (double )itim / diskbench_time; + dlt=dlt/(double )DISKREFSCORE; + cpu_score=dlt; + fprintf(stdout,"Ubench DISK: %d\n",cpu_score); +@@ -140,13 +140,13 @@ int diskbench() + itim=diskcalibrate(DISKREFTIME); + if ( ONEflag ) + { +- dlt=itim*(double )DISKBENCH_TIME/(double )DISKREFTIME/(double )DISKREFSCORE; ++ dlt=itim*(double )diskbench_time/(double )DISKREFTIME/(double )DISKREFSCORE; + cpu_score=dlt; + fprintf(stdout,"Ubench Single DISK: %d (%.2fs)\n", + cpu_score,diskload(itim)); + return cpu_score; + } +- alarm(DISKBENCH_TIME); ++ alarm(diskbench_time); + child_pid[child_number]=fork(); + if ( child_pid[child_number] == -1 ) + { |
